#42fb5d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#42fb5d is composed of 25.9% red, 98.4%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.9%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 128.8 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 62.2%. #42fb5d color hex could be obtained by blending #84ffba with #00f700.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#42fb5d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#effff1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#42fb5d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ba29c is the less saturated color, while #42fb5d is the most saturated one.
